huangfen2002 发表于 2016-10-30 06:16:46

jdbc连接SQL server数据

  
  

package jdbcConnectionSqlserver2005;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
public class jdbcConnectionSqlserver {
public static void main(String[] args) {
Connection conn = null;
Statement st = null;
ResultSet rs = null;
try {
/* 连接的SQL SERVER2005 */
// 1.加载驱动
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ver");
// 2.创建连接
conn = DriverManager.getConnection(
"jdbc:sqlserver://localhost:1433;databasename=test",
"sa", "wdpc");
// 3.获取指令对象
st = conn.createStatement();
// 4.发送指令,并返回结果
rs = st.executeQuery("select * from jdbc");
// 5.处理结果
while(rs.next()){
System.out.println("id" +rs.getInt(1));
System.out.println("userName" +rs.getString(2));
}
} catch (ClassNotFoundException e) {
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
}finally {
// 关闭对象
try {
if (rs != null) {
rs.close();
}
if (st != null) {
st.close();
}
if (conn != null) {
conn.close();
}
} catch (SQLException e) {
e.printStackTrace();
}
}
}
}

  
  如果建的是java 工程 在建工程的时候就把sqljdbc4.jar 驱动包导入
  

 
  
  
  如果工程已经建好就在
  

 中导入。
  
  
  
  
  
  
  
页: [1]
查看完整版本: jdbc连接SQL server数据